python3 | print()语句
print()内的语句可以用加号"+ " 或者逗号"," 进行拼接,但是两者最后显示的效果却不同
加号拼接
逗号拼接
如图所示,用逗号拼接的结果,中间会多出一下空格
注意:加号拼接的两遍应该是同一数据类型,否则报错;而逗号则可以将任意两个类型的数据进行拼接
比如计算一年有多少秒这个题目:
DaysPerYear = 365
HoursPerDay = 24
MinutesPerHour = 60
SecondsPerMinute = 60
Seconds = DaysPerYear * HoursPerDay * MinutesPerHour * SecondsPerMinute
print(“一年有” + Seconds + “秒”)
结果
因为一年有 和 秒是字符串,而Seconds是被赋值了一个数字,所以不能简单相加,处理方式有两种
方法1,